It is in the middle of nowhere.. we were driving from Ketchum to Jackson Hole WY, decided to pass the sawtooth and then Stanley..was a great stop somewhere in the middle. Clean restroom and a boat ramp on the river.
Sep 21, 2018 · Rahul ShivhareI love the improvement made to the area for sportsman and general public it's nice to have an area to chill or just fish
Jul 02, 2018 · GilliesWe relaxed by the Salmon River for a few hours and enjoyed the cold water.
Sep 21, 2020 · Kirk CloydThis campground is very well maintained!
Jul 01, 2022 · Michael MillerQuite little area. Nice and peaceful.
